Aradia decided on this day to try her hand at hunting. She had never been hunting before, and Red was too busy with his Endal duties to take her. So being the stubborn person she was, she decided to go by herself. Once she made it to the Unforgiving Forest, she quickly decided that maybe it just wasn’t the best of ideas. But the little Singer was determined to learn how to hunt, she was decent with the bow, so why not use that for something good. Why not provide some food to Wind Reach, every little bit would help feed the mouths of the city.

Aradia gave a sorrowful sigh, as she walked through the thick forest. She was not sure which way to go, what trail to take, what to look for. But she kept her eyes open, observing her surroundings closely with an intense need to do good. She walked a little ways into the forest, maybe more than a little, the Singer had lost track of time trying to find some kind of animal print in the ground. She kept walking a few more paces, staring at the soil beneath her feet, until she finally found a print. She did not know enough about hunting to determine what animal it may belong to, but it obviously had claws, and was quite large. The prints led further into the thick foliage, which made Aradia shiver with a little fright.

If it had claws, that could mean that it was a predator, which could mean she was acting as a prey right now, which could also mean that she was about to die. Aradia brought herself back up from the ground, standing at her full height, as her eyes darted around the thick foliage, trying to find a pair of eyes watching her. The Singer’s heart started to beat against her chest, a loud thumping that echoed in her ears. She needed to hunt the animal down to kill it, to bring food to Wind Reach, but she did not want to be the one that was being hunted. The little Singer was scared, scared that she had inadvertently become prey for some hungry animal.

The sound of twigs snapping under something or someone made Aradia jerk around to see who or what it was. Unfortunately a little squeak, that was supposed to be a scream, emitted from the woman as she looked around like a mad woman, trying to determine where the sound was coming from. What have I gotten myself into now… Aradia thought to herself, as her wide violet eyes tried to find the source of the sound…

For anyone who didn't know the fiery Inartan, they wouldn't have thought that they'd see her going back into the Unforgiving again. For anyone else being hunted and the near death experience may have been enough to keep them away for the rest of their natural life. But Aela wasn't just any girl out for adventure. There was something that she looked to claim, something that she needed to do to prove to herself that she was in fact as good as the Endal.

The little huntress had doubts about herself as others did, but she would never allow herself to give up or to stop believing that she could accomplish anything that she put her mind to. Her dream had been shattered, tiny pieces blown into the winds never to be put together again, but Aela wasn't done yet. As long as she breathed, as long as she could fight, she would find a way to claim what she wanted, that or make a new dream.

She often thought about it, a new dream sounded nice, but she had no idea how she would go about it. How could a person give up on a life long dream and find one to replace it, was that even possible? Aela wasn't sure, nor was she willing to give up on something that had pushed her forward since her days as a yasi. But for now, she would bide her time and work on other skills. Which is what led her back to the Unforgiving.

The forest in Spring and Summer were filled with game and predators alike. It was dangerous be it could also but rewarding if she caught enough game. To this point, the little huntress arrived back in the forest with her bow and quiver as well as her hunting kit. She now had two knives as well as traps and rope to help with catching and storing game. She left her normal arrows at home and instead brought mostly game arrows with a few for fishing should she decide to attempt that as well. Aela was ready this time, she would take on the hunt as if she were a pro and most of all she would have patience....she hoped.

The curly haired blonde made her way from the road and into the brush. Her loving pet Gyrfalcon had perched himself upon the heavy bag at her back. Aela stopped just before she entered the brush and lifted her arm which was wrapped with a leather gauntlet and called to Skye. The falcon screeched and flapped his wings to lift himself into the air high enough to soar over her head and land on her arm.

"Okay, we're going to try this again and this time you're not going to rush off and leave me to get my own food. We eat together understand?" Aela instructed in a motherly tone to her pet. Skye stared at her curious, even clacking his beak as if offering her a retort. "Oh don't you give me beak! Just do it." She jerked her arm then, prompting Skye to rise up and fly into the forest. Aela wasn't the best falconer by far but she did her best to train him. Once he cleared the opening and entered the tree line, her hazel eyes lowered and found red amongst the green bushes. By now the girl had learned to identify it as the red hair of other hunters.

"Hey!" she called out. "Are you setting up here, I can go further if I need too."
